Latest Patents

Fulcher's latest inventions include:

1. **Variable Fuel Gas Moisture Control for Gas Turbine Combustor**: This innovative system addresses the moisture content of fuel gas supplied to gas turbines during part-load operations. By modulating the flow of heated water to a fuel moisturizer, the invention minimizes combustion dynamics and complies with emission requirements. The system utilizes heated water from a heat recovery steam generator, which not only moisturizes the fuel gas but also increases overall combined cycle efficiency by enhancing mass flow.

2. **Angled Vanes in Combustor Flow Sleeve**: This patent involves a turbine combustor liner assembly that significantly improves airflow. It features a combustor liner with a transition duct, and a first flow sleeve that surrounds the liner. The innovation includes a first annular inlet equipped with a number of circumferentially spaced, angled flow vanes. These vanes swirl air entering the flow passage, optimizing combustion performance.
